Enables 1-acylglycerol-3-phosphate O-acyltransferase activity and 1-acylglycerophosphocholine O-acyltransferase activity. Predicted to be involved in phosphatidylcholine acyl-chain remodeling and phospholipid biosynthetic process. Predicted to act upstream of or within several processes, including negative regulation of phosphatidylcholine biosynthetic process; positive regulation of protein catabolic process; and surfactant homeostasis. Predicted to be located in several cellular components, including Golgi apparatus; endoplasmic reticulum; and lipid droplet. Orthologous to human LPCAT1 (lysophosphatidylcholine acyltransferase 1).
